Yamaha DT125RE

Yamaha DT125RE
Manufacturer Yamaha
Production 2005–2007/2008
Class Enduro-supermotard
Engine 123 cc liquid cooled, Single, two-stroke, Reed valve
Top speed 110 km/h (68 mph)
Power 12.92 kW (17.33 hp) @ 7,000 rpm
Transmission manual 6-speed
Suspension Front: 41mm Telescopic fork
Rear: Swingarm (monocross)
Brakes Front: 230mm Disc
Rear: 230mm Disc
Tires Front: 2.75-21
Rear: 4.10-18
Wheelbase 260 mm (10 in)
Dimensions L: 865 mm (34.1 in)
W: 1,165 mm (45.9 in)
H: 1,340 mm (53 in)
Seat height 885mm
Weight 116 kg (256 lb) (dry)
Fuel capacity 10 L (2.2 imp gal; 2.6 US gal)
Oil capacity 1.2 L (1.3 US qt)

The Yamaha DT 125 RE is a trail bike produced from 2004 to 2007 (some can have 2008 as the registration year).

The bike is a 125cc two-stroke single cylinder limited to 11 kW which makes it very popular for teens with an A1 license.

It shares an engine with the DT125R, the Derbi GPR 125, the TZR125 and the TDR125.

Frame and plastics have been updated to be more durable and modern looking compared to the DT125 model.
